Tom Nicholson - Business Systems Officer

A childs drawing of TomTom worked in the NHS from being 16 years old, with roles in HR, Purchasing and Occupational Health (to name but a few!) and has picked up an impressive collection of qualifications in business, customer care and IT along the way.

What do you do? Admin systems development and maintenance, IT support, admin office supervisor, graphic design, marketing, web development and everyones general go-to guy!

What is the best thing about your job? Freedom to express and be creative, plenty of opportunity and encouragement to learn new skills and the people I work with are just amazing!
